Code P0B82 Cadillac Description

The P0B82 code for Cadillac vehicles specifically relates to the Hybrid/Electric Vehicle Battery 15 Circuit Performance. This code indicates an issue with the performance of the circuit related to the hybrid or electric vehicle battery system. The hybrid/electric vehicle battery 15 circuit is responsible for managing the flow of electricity between the battery and the vehicle's systems, ensuring proper functioning and efficiency.

OBDII Code P0B82 Cadillac - Hybrid/Electric Vehicle Battery 15 Circuit Performance
P0B82 Cadillac Code - Hybrid/Electric Vehicle Battery 15 Circuit Performance

Common Causes of P0B82 Cadillac

  1. Faulty wiring or connectors in the hybrid/electric battery circuit
  2. Malfunctioning battery control module
  3. Damaged hybrid/electric vehicle battery
  4. Software issues related to the hybrid/electric system
  5. Environmental factors such as extreme temperatures affecting battery performance

Symptoms of P0B82 Cadillac

  1. Reduced fuel efficiency
  2. Loss of power or acceleration
  3. Check engine light illuminated on the dashboard
  4. Inability to switch between hybrid and electric modes
  5. Issues with starting the vehicle

How to Fix P0B82 Cadillac

  1. Perform a thorough diagnostic check to pinpoint the exact cause of the issue
  2. Inspect and test the wiring, connectors, and battery control module for any faults or damage
  3. Replace any damaged components such as wiring, connectors, or the battery control module
  4. Reset the system and clear the error code to see if the issue has been resolved
  5. Test drive the vehicle to ensure the problem has been effectively addressed

Cost to Fix P0B82 Cadillac

The cost of repairing a P0B82 code related to the Hybrid/Electric Vehicle Battery 15 Circuit Performance can vary depending on the extent of the issue and the specific components that need to be replaced. On average, the repair costs for this type of problem can range from $200 to $800, including parts and labor. It's essential to consider the specific diagnosis time and labor rates at auto repair shops, which can vary based on factors such as location, vehicle make and model, and engine type. Checking local rates and obtaining multiple quotes is recommended for a more accurate estimate.

Frequently Asked Questions about P0B82 Cadillac Code

1. What does the OBDII code P0B82 mean on a Cadillac?

The P0B82 code indicates a performance issue in the Hybrid/Electric Vehicle Battery 15 Circuit, which refers to one of the battery modules or circuits in the hybrid or electric vehicle system.

2. What are the common symptoms of the P0B82 code?

Symptoms may include reduced hybrid/electric performance, warning lights on the dashboard, decreased fuel economy, or the vehicle entering limp mode.

3. What causes the P0B82 code to appear on a Cadillac?

Common causes include a faulty battery module, damaged wiring or connectors in the battery circuit, a malfunctioning battery control module, or internal corrosion in the battery pack.

4. Can I continue driving my Cadillac with the P0B82 code?

It is not recommended to drive for an extended period with this code, as it may lead to further damage to the hybrid/electric system or reduced vehicle performance.

5. How is the P0B82 code diagnosed?

A technician will typically use a diagnostic scanner to check for stored codes, inspect wiring and connectors in the battery circuit, and test the voltage and performance of the affected battery module.

6. How do you fix the P0B82 code on a Cadillac?

Repairs may include replacing the faulty battery module, repairing damaged wiring or connectors, recalibrating or replacing the battery control module, or addressing internal issues within the battery pack.

7. How much does it cost to repair the P0B82 code?

Repair costs can vary widely, ranging from $200 for minor wiring repairs to over $1,000 if a battery module or control unit needs replacement.

8. Can a weak 12V battery cause the P0B82 code?

While unlikely, a weak 12V battery can sometimes cause related electrical issues. However, this code specifically pertains to the high-voltage hybrid/electric battery circuit.

9. Is the P0B82 code covered under warranty?

If your Cadillac is still under the hybrid/electric system warranty, the repair may be covered. Check with your dealership for warranty details.

10. Can clearing the code fix the P0B82 issue?

Clearing the code will temporarily remove it, but if the underlying problem is not resolved, the code and its symptoms will likely return.
